[ codeigniter ] HTMLPurifier.standalone.php php7.4 {$i} {0} 등에 관한 오류 대처 수정 > Codeigniter

본문 바로가기

사이트 내 전체검색

Codeigniter

팁자료 [ codeigniter ] HTMLPurifier.standalone.php php7.4 {$i} {0} 등에 관한 오류 대…

작성일 21-08-30 10:44

페이지 정보

작성자 웹지기 조회 2,175회 댓글 0건

본문

 php7.4에서 

$str = "test";

echo($str{0});

이러한 코드로 사용이 가능했던 부분이 수정되어

$str = "test";

echo($str[0]);

이러한 코드로 사용을 해야 오류가 발생하지 않는다.

/plugin/htmnlpurifier/HTMLPurifier.standalone.php 3908 줄

$in = ord($str{$i}); php7.4 대처 구문 수정 =>{$i} 대신 [$i] 사용

$in = ord($str[$i]);

HTMLPurifier.standalone.php 14197줄

if ($raw{0} != '(') { php7.4 대처 구문 수정 =>{0} 대신 [0] 사용

if ($raw[0] != '(') {

HTMLPurifier.standalone.php 20530 줄

if ($attr['size']{0} == '+' || $attr['size']{0} == '-') { php7.4 대처 구문 수정 =>{0} 대신 [0] 사용

if ($attr['size'][0] == '+' || $attr['size'][0] == '-') { 

 



추천0

비추천 0

댓글목록

등록된 댓글이 없습니다.

전체 20건 1 페이지

이미지 목록

게시물 검색
Copyright © 즐거운 코딩 생활 ( funyphp ). All rights reserved.
PC 버전으로 보기